Auckland: All-rounder James Faulkner was on Wednesday ruled out of Australia‘s cricket tour of New Zealand after injuring his right hamstring. He was injured during Australia’s 159-run loss to New Zealand at Eden Park in the first One-Day here on Wednesday. Australia will play three One-Days and two Tests in New Zealand. The second match is in Wellington on February 6. Faulkner was replaced in the squad by young all-rounder Marcus Stoinis. “Unfortunately, with the short turnaround between games we do not believe he will recover in time to take any further part in the series. As a result, he will return to Melbourne tomorrow to have scans and start rehabilitation. Commenting on the decision to call-up Stoinis, national selector Rod Marsh said: “It’s unfortunate that James has suffered this injury but the situation presents another good opportunity for Marcus Stoinis. He is a promising young all-rounder who had a taste of international cricket last winter in England, and hopefully this call-up will continue with his development.”

Stoinis has played jut a single One-Day so far but has put up a commendable performance in the recently concluded Big Bash League which might have acted behind the decision taken by the team management.
